Hey Pascal! May 04 21:58 04, Pascal Schmidt wrote to Maurice Kinal: PS> I wasn't aware of the length requirements. If I recall correctly a "proper" MSGID contains two fields or columns, the first the originating address and the second an eight character field that should be unique within that area. PS> Well, for dupe checking, you only need to do a full string compare, PS> no parsing of the MSGID required. If I were to write a tosser, I PS> wouldn't look at the structure of MSGID lines at all. That is fine for your specific tosser but what about the ones that exist and fully expect that a MSGID as per the documented specs? If any tosser up or down stream from/to you then your tosser in all probably will never have to need to deal with it since these will be filtered out. Right?
